MiniPID 2: PID Sensor Lamp Explained
Introduction: MiniPID 2 PID Sensors and How They Work ION Science MiniPID 2 consist of a high energy output, ultraviolet lamp and three electrodes. Volatile Organic Compounds (VOCs) enter the detection chamber and are ionised by the ultraviolet light. A negative charged electron is ejected from the molecule making it positively charged. UVF-TRILOGY Analyzer Introduced
Summer 2018: Sitelab's new hydrocarbon analyzer, the UVF-TRILOGY, has replaced the UVF-3100 models. This instrument can do the same tests, but uses new deep UV LEDs to detect hydrocarbons instead of a UV lamp. Hanovia Launches Quantum Medium Pressure UV System
Hanovia has just launched its new Quantum in-line medium pressure UV system. This low-cost device is designed specifically for small-flow industrial process water applications (up to 120 m3/hr) in the food, beverage, brewing, pharmaceutical and electronics industries.
